Athens is preparing to host the second Panathenea festival, an international event organized by young Greeks that blends technology and the arts.

What began as a small, uncertain effort has grown into a major gathering for innovation. Co-founder and CEO Lefteris Katsiadakis said attendance is expected to rise from 3,500 last year to 10,000 this year.

The three-day festival, held May 27-29 at Zappeion Hall, will involve about 440 organizers and volunteers. Participants include representatives of major investment funds and technology companies, alongside founders and executives from across the innovation sector. Discussions will focus on artificial intelligence, defense and robotics.

The program also expands into film and music, with artists networking with industry representatives. More than 80 parallel events will take place across Athens, underscoring the city’s central role in the festival.
